Most machines are made ‘fail safe’, meaning they will shut down if some part of the system fails. Think of a lawnmower – you have to hold down the handle for it to work. That’s so if the owner say collapses while using it, it doesn’t continue to spin it’s lethal blade. A bomb designer, depending on the level of evil, could have designed their bomb around the opposite principle. The circuit or mechanism is actually *preventing* the bomb from going off, so it will explode of the interrupted.

If this is the case, bomb disposal needs to be carefully planned and carried out. More likely, they will detonate it under controlled conditions.
